Coalmont, TN map Population (year 2000): 948. Estimated population in July 2006: 964 (+1.7% change)
 

Males: 451  (47.6%)
Females: 497  (52.4%)

Grundy County

Median resident age:  34.8 years
Tennessee median age:  35.9 years

Zip codes: 37313.


Estimated median household income in 2005: $21,200 (it was $21,750 in 2000)
Coalmont  $21,200
Tennessee:  $38,874

Estimated median house/condo value in 2005: $55,800 (it was $54,500 in 2000)
Coalmont  $55,800
Tennessee:  $114,000

Coalmont-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Tennessee state average. It is 90%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 4/3/1974, a category 5 (max. wind speeds 261-318 mph) tornado 22.2 miles away from the Coalmont city center killed 16 people and injured 190 people.

On 4/3/1974,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 25.0 miles away from the city center killed 11 people and injured 121 people and caused between $500,000 and $5,000,000 in damages.
